Bonjour,
Je suis débutant en xsl et j'ai le problème suivant à résoudre :
J'ai un fichier xml ci dessous en entrée :
Je souhaite d'avoir le fichier ci dessous en sortie qui reprendre les informations du document dont la date de validité la plus récente
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36 <ns0:Employes> <Employe> <Document> <TypeDocument>FRAPR</TypeDocument> <ValiditeDebut>2007-08-01</ValiditeDebut> <ValiditeFin>2999-12-31</ValiditeFin> </Document> <Document> <TypeDocument>FRAST</TypeDocument> <ValiditeDebut>2010-01-26</ValiditeDebut> <ValiditeFin>2010-04-25</ValiditeFin> </Document> <Document> <TypeDocument>FRAST</TypeDocument> <ValiditeDebut>2010-12-30</ValiditeDebut> <ValiditeFin>2011-03-29</ValiditeFin> </Document> </Employe> <Employe> <Document> <TypeDocument>FRAPR</TypeDocument> <ValiditeDebut>2007-08-01</ValiditeDebut> <ValiditeFin>2010-12-31</ValiditeFin> </Document> <Document> <TypeDocument>FRAST</TypeDocument> <ValiditeDebut>2010-01-26</ValiditeDebut> <ValiditeFin>2011-04-25</ValiditeFin> </Document> <Document> <TypeDocument>FRAST</TypeDocument> <ValiditeDebut>2010-12-30</ValiditeDebut> <ValiditeFin>2012-03-29</ValiditeFin> </Document> </Employe> </ns0:Employes>
Pouvez-vous me dire comment je dois faire en xslt s'il vous plaît ?
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12 <Employe> <Document> <TypeDocument>FRAPR</TypeDocument> <ValiditeFin>2999-12-31</ValiditeFin> </Document> </Employe> <Employe> <Document> <TypeDocument>FRAST</TypeDocument> <ValiditeFin>2012-03-29</ValiditeFin> </Document> </Employe>
Merci d'avance.
Partager